The Rolling Stones Between The Buttons UK Mono Vinyl LP (1967) Label Variant
A nice original UK mono unboxed Decca pressing of this 1967 album by the Rolling Stones.
One owner from new - from the collection of pop journalist Paul Scudamore (who wrote for the Record Mirror under the nom de plume Mike Adams); likely sent to him as a review copy.
Well loved and well played.
Disc G; worn with light hairlines but free from scratches; associated surface noise; crackle; occasional pops; plays without skipping; light scuff to band five of side one; spindle marks to labels, which are otherwise clean and bright.
Inner sleeve Fair; age toning; separated at both edges; otherwise clean and quite sharp; plastic inner intact.
Sleeve G; handling wear; light creasing to Clarifoil; spine sl. squished; rear a little grubby; previous owner's name to top left corner.
A variant label which I cannot see recorded anywhere: deep groove; K/T tax code on the second side only; tracklisting typeface for side one is serif; different for side two, which is sans serif; 'Mirage Music' to left on side two; to right on side one.
Matrices XARL-7644-4A XARL-7645-6A
